Filing and Recording Procedures for Mechanics Lien Bonds
The filing and recording procedures for mechanics lien bonds vary by jurisdiction but generally follow specific statutory guidelines. Accurate documentation and timely submission are essential to ensure validity. Typically, the process involves submitting the bond to the appropriate government office, often the county recorder’s or clerk’s office, along with required forms and supporting documents.
Key steps include completing the necessary paperwork, paying applicable fees, and ensuring all information, such as project details, bond amount, and surety information, are correctly included. Once filed, the bond becomes part of the public record, providing notice to interested parties.
To avoid delays or invalidation, parties should verify according to local regulations. Some jurisdictions may require notarization or additional affidavits. Proper adherence to these procedures ensures the mechanics lien bonding process is legally recognized and enforceable, protecting all involved parties.

Bond Release and Claim Resolution
When a mechanics lien bond is issued, its primary purpose is to provide a guarantee that claims will be resolved without litigation, and it facilitates the release of the bond. The bond release occurs once the underlying claim is either satisfied, settled, or legally resolved, which generally involves submitting a formal request to the appropriate authorities or parties. This process confirms that the lien claim has been discharged, enabling the property owner or contractor to clear the title of the lien restriction.
Claim resolution involves thorough negotiations or legal procedures to address disputes over the lien or bond validity. This may include settling the amount owed, disputing the claim, or demonstrating proof of payment. If a dispute arises, parties can often resolve the claim amicably through mediation or arbitration, avoiding prolonged litigation. If unresolved, the matter may proceed to court for a binding decision.
The final step in the process is the official release of the mechanics lien bond, which is typically documented with a release of lien form or a court order, depending on jurisdiction. Proper documentation ensures clarity and legal record of the claim’s resolution, and it allows the property to be unencumbered, restoring its marketability.
Effect of a Mechanics Lien Bond on the Construction Project
The mechanics lien bond positively impacts a construction project by minimizing potential delays caused by lien claims. When a lien bond is in place, it replaces the original mechanics lien, allowing work to continue without interruption. This ensures project timelines remain intact and reduces financial risks for contractors and owners.
Additionally, the presence of a mechanics lien bond can enhance project credibility and foster smoother negotiations among stakeholders. It provides assurance that subcontractors and suppliers will receive payment even if disputes arise, leading to improved trust and collaboration during construction activities.
